The 807T allele in alpha2 integrin is protective against atherosclerotic arterial wall thickening and the occurrence of plaque in patients with type 2 diabetes.

Abstract excerpt
Polymorphism of alpha2 integrin (C807T) is shown to be associated with an increased incidence of thrombotic cardiovascular events. However, it is not clear whether this polymorphism is associated with atherosclerotic arterial wall thickening.
